Warning Signs You Need Rental Property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and even liability issues. That’s why it’s essential to stay vigilant and address potential water damage issues quickly. Here are some common warning signs you should look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show mold and mildew growth which can pose serious health risks to your tenants. Don’t ignore musty smells, address them immediately to prevent further damage and health concerns.

Water Stains and Warping on Ceilings and Walls

Water stains and warping can show water damage and structural issues. Don’t delay, address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and ensure the structural integrity of your rental property.

Flooding or Water Leaks in Basements or Crawlspaces

Flooding or water leaks can cause significant damage and pose health risks. Don’t wait, address these issues immediately to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ment for your tenants.

Discoloration or Warping of Flooring and Carpets

Discoloration or warping of flooring and carpets can show water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, address them quickly to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and healthy environment for your tenants.

Unusual Noises or Sounds from Plumbing or Appliances

Unusual noises or sounds can show plumbing or appliance issues which can lead to water damage and health concerns. Don’t delay, address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ment for your tenants.

Visible Signs of Mold and Mildew Growth

Mold and mildew growth can pose serious health risks to your tenants. Don’t ignore visible signs of mold and mildew, address them immediately to prevent further damage and health concerns.

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ill or leak (less than 1 gallon) Yes No You can likely handle small spills on your own using basic cleaning supplies.
Large water leak or flood (more than 1 gallon) No Yes A large water leak or flood need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.
Mold and mildew growth in a small area No Yes Mold and mildew growth needs specialized cleaning and remediation techniques to prevent further damage and health risks.
Water damage in a rental property with multiple units No Yes Water damage in a rental property with multiple units needs specialized expertise and equipment to handle safely and effectively.
Water damage in a rental property with sensitive equipment or appliances No Yes Water damage in a rental property with sensitive equipment or appliances needs specialized expertise and equipment to handle safely and effectively.
Water damage in a rental property with structural issues No Yes Water damage in a rental property with structural issues needs specialized expertise and equipment to handle safely and effectively.

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ration Cost In Parker, TX

Estimating Costs

The cost of water damage restoration in rental properties can vary widely dep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Parker, TX. That’s why it’s essential to work with a reputable and experienced restoration service like ours. We’ll provide you with a detailed estimate of the costs involved and help you navigate the insurance cla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and complexity of the job
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ning products needed, and complexity of the job
Structural Repairs and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, and complexity of the job
Final Inspection and Certification $100 – $500 Complexity of the job and type of certification needed
Insurance Claims Support $0 – $500 Complexity of the claims process and type of support needed
